需求

在將 Webex Contact Center 與 ServiceNow 控制台整合之前,請確保您已具備以下各項:

更新集僅適用於開發人員實例。

結合

請遵循以下兩種方法之一:

對於開發人員許可實例,我們建議您按照開發人員許可實例下 的步驟操作

如果您擁有企業許可實例,請遵循企業許可實例 準則。

我們不建議將企業許可的應用與開發人員沙盒實例混合使用。

為開發人員實例安裝 ServiceNow

以下部分介紹了為開發人員實例安裝 ServiceNow 連接器的步驟。

安裝 ServiceNow Openframe 外掛程式

1

以系統管理員身分登入您的 ServiceNow 執行個體。

2

轉到 所有>系統定義>外掛程式

3

搜索 Openframe 並安裝外掛程式。

提交更新集

1

下載 github 儲存庫上最新的系統更新集 XML 檔,網址為: https://github.com/webex/webex-contact-center-crm-connectors/blob/main/servicenow/updateSet.xml

檔案名稱:updateSet.XML

2

以系統管理員身分登入您的 ServiceNow 執行個體。

3

轉到 所有>檢索到的更新集

4

單擊 “從 XML 導入更新集 ”,然後選擇一個檔以載入 .XML 檔。

5

按一下上載

6

按兩下創建的更新集名稱,然後按下 預覽更新集。

7

按兩下 提交更新集完成。

指派角色給代理

需要為代理指定兩個系統角色和一個自訂角色:

  • sn_openframe_user (系統角色)
  • interaction_agent (系統角色)
  • CC 代理 (自訂角色)

1

轉到 所有>系統安全性>組

2

搜尋要編輯的群組,然後按一下名稱。

3

按兩下 編輯 以更改角色。

4

新增以下角色:

  1. x_caci_crm_wxcc。CC 代理

  2. sn_openframe_user

  3. interaction_agent

5

按一下儲存

6

點擊群組成員 Tab > 編輯 以新增您的使用者。

7

將使用者添加到清單,完成後按下保存

建立 Openframe 設定

1

轉到 所有> Openframe > 配置

2

按一下新增

3

輸入以下最小值:

  1. 名稱:WxCC for ServiceNow

  2. 標題:Wxcc

  3. 副標題:適用於服務現在

  4. 作用中:真

  5. 寬度:300

  6. 高度:500

  7. 圖示類:圖示電話

  8. 使用者群組 (電話圖示僅對這些使用者顯示):[選取具有 CC 代理角色的使用者群組]

  9. 網址:x_caci_crm_wxcc_gadget.do

  10. 配置 (有關詳細資訊,請參閱自定義 Tab):

    [

    {“鍵”:“區域”,“值”:“us1”}

    ]

為企業許可實例安裝 ServiceNow

以下部分介紹為生產實例安裝 ServiceNow 連接器的步驟。

安裝 ServiceNow Openframe 外掛程式

1

以系統管理員身分登入您的 ServiceNow 執行個體。

2

轉到 所有>系統定義>外掛程式

3

搜索 Openframe 並安裝外掛程式。

安裝 Webex Contact Center 應用程式

擁有企業授權的實例可以直接從 ServiceNow Store 安裝 Webex Contact Center 應用程式。

1

要下載並安裝 Webex Contact Center 軟體包,請訪問 ServiceNow 商店: https://store.servicenow.com/

2

在「搜尋 」欄位中 輸入 Webex Contact Center

3

從搜尋結果中,選擇 Cisco Webex Contact Center ,然後按兩下 獲取 以安裝包。

若要下載舊版,請從搜尋結果中單擊 Webex Contact Center ,然後按兩下 獲取 以安裝包。

指派角色給代理

需要為代理指定兩個系統角色和一個自訂角色:

  • sn_openframe_user (系統角色)
  • interaction_agent (系統角色)
  • CC 代理 (自訂角色)

1

轉到 所有>系統安全性>組

2

搜尋要編輯的群組,然後按一下名稱。

3

按兩下 編輯 以更改角色。

4

新增以下角色:

  1. x_caci_crm_wxcc。CC 代理

  2. sn_openframe_user

  3. interaction_agent

5

按一下儲存

6

點擊群組成員 Tab > 編輯 以新增您的使用者。

7

將使用者添加到清單,完成後按下保存

建立 Openframe 設定

1

轉到 所有> Openframe > 配置

2

按一下新增

3

輸入以下最小值:

  1. 名稱:WxCC for ServiceNow

  2. 標題:Wxcc

  3. 副標題:適用於服務現在

  4. 作用中:真

  5. 寬度:300

  6. 高度:500

  7. 圖示類:圖示電話

  8. 使用者群組 (電話圖示僅對這些使用者顯示):[選取具有 CC 代理角色的使用者群組]

  9. 網址:x_caci_crm_wxcc_gadget.do

  10. 配置 (有關詳細資訊,請參閱自定義 Tab):

    [

    {“鍵”:“區域”,“值”:“us1”}

    ]

自訂

以下部分說明如何配置和自定義 Webex Contact Center ServiceNow Agent Desktop 應用程式。 您可以定製和自動化各種工作流程,以説明代理管理 Webex Contact Center Agent Desktop. 中的呼入和呼出通話

Openframe 組態屬性自訂

下表詳細介紹如何自訂自訂桌面佈局檔案的屬性。 定製 ServiceNow 的行為以滿足您的特定業務需求。

Openframe 組態金鑰屬性

描述

代理使用的 Wxcc 區域

  • 北美:美國 1
  • 加拿大:ca1
  • 英國:歐盟 1
  • 歐盟:歐盟 2 國
  • 亞太正義中心:ANZ1
  • 日本:日本 1
  • 新加坡:第 1 研究組

共用記錄變數

CAD 變數,用於保存交互的 Sys_Id,並用於更改已轉移呼叫的記錄的擁有權。

[預設值:sharedRecordId]任何 CAD 變數

開啟通知

啟用基於瀏覽器的彈出通知。

[預設:假] 真或假

螢幕彈出沒有符合

當找不到新客戶或新案例時,自動按下「新記錄連結」(取決於螢幕 PopIncomingMode)

[預設:假] 真或假

螢幕彈出來電模式要在來電中搜尋的記錄類型。與 customerTable 或 caseTable 保持一致。[預設:客戶]客戶、案例、互動或已停用
客戶表

用於搜索客戶並使用「新記錄連結」創建新客戶記錄的表。

使用者(ITSM)= sys_user

聯絡人(CSM)= customer_contact

[預設:使用者]使用者或聯絡人
案例表

用於搜索案例並使用「新記錄連結」創建新案例記錄的表。

事件(ITSM)= 事件

案例(CSM)= sn_customerservice_case

[預設值:事件]案例或事件
尋找欄位

要在表上查詢的欄位以逗號分隔。

範例:電話

[預設:電話,mobile_phone]在 customerTable 或 caseTable 中定義的表格上的任何欄位
尋找變數

用於查詢表中的入站通話的值。

範例:CADIncidentNumCollected

[預設:ANI]ANI 或任何 CAD 變數
lookupResultFields

標籤顯示在連接器頂部,用於查詢進行中電話通話的結果。

範例:名稱、位置

[預設值:名稱、職稱、部門]在 customerTable 或 caseTable 中定義的表上最多有三個字段。
國家代碼移除

執行尋找之前要從 ANI 或 CAD 變數中移除的逗號分隔的首碼。

範例:+1,+49,+41

[預設值:]任何國家/地區代碼
客戶記錄映射

映射以創建具有「新記錄連結」的新客戶記錄並填充 CAD 變數數據。

範例:

caller_id={ani};employee_number={CADVariable3}

案例記錄映射

映射以使用「新記錄連結」創建新案例記錄並填充數據。

範例:

caller_id={ani};u_cisco_queue={QueueName}

活動記錄對應交互數據填充的映射。

範例:

short_description={ani};u_call_disposition={CADCallResult}

omniReasonCrm[A(10]

接收語音通話時 CRM 通道上的“不可用”AWA ServiceNow 狀態。

若要獲取此值,請轉到“高級工作指派>設置”>“狀態”。 右鍵按下所需的狀態,然後按下「複製 sys_id」。

示例:7f888794dbd28e10999d8c3b1396198b

任何 AWA 狀態 Sys_Id
全能理性之聲

代理接收入站聊天時使用的 WxCC「空閒」輔助代碼的 ID。

範例:cff0ca82-c623-4cde-aaf1-4e17f268f7f7

任何 wxCC 空閒輔助代碼
webRtcDomainWebRTC 域。 根據區域選擇域。
  • 美國:rtw.prod-us1.rtmsprod.net
  • 澳新銀行:rtw.prod-as1.rtmsprod.net
  • CA:rtw.prod-ca1.rtmsprod.net
  • JP:rtw.prod-ja1.rtmsprod.net
  • 歐盟 1:rtw.prod-uk1.rtmsprod.net
  • 歐盟 2:rtw.prod-gm1.rtmsprod.net
  • 新加坡:rtw.prod-sn1.rtmsprod.net
enableAwaChannelSync

啟用 Cisco WxCC 狀態和 ServiceNow AWA 狀態之間的代理狀態同步。

此同步是雙向的,並且基於 ServiceNow 和 Cisco 狀態的名稱。

  • True
  • False

範例組態

下面是一個設定範例,它允許:

  • 在「事件」表上進行查找 (基於在 IVR 上收集的事件編號)
  • 在無符合項時建立記錄
  • 全管道的狀態變更

[

{“鍵”:“區域”,“值”:“eu2”},

{“鍵”:“螢幕彈出來電模式”,“值”:“大小寫”},

{“Key”:“customerTable”,“Value”:“Users”},

{“Key”:“customerRecordMapping”,“Value”:“phone={ani};mobile_phone={ani}“},

{“鍵”:“案例表”,“值”:“事件”},

{“Key”:“caseRecordMapping”,“Value”:“product=8583ce8237732000158bbfc8bcbe5dd9;short_description={ani}“},

{“Key”:“lookupFields”,“Value”:“numbephoner”},

{“Key”:“lookupVariable”,“Value”:“IVR_Incident_Number”},

{“Key”:“lookupResultFields”,“Value”:“short_description,caller_id,priority”},

{“Key”:“enableNotifications”,“Value”:“true”},

{“Key”:“omniReasonCrm”,“Value”:“7f888794dbd28e10999d8c3b1396198b”},

{“Key”:“omniReasonVoice”,“Value”:“868643ae-c1ed-4849-a5be-a3deaa54f97b”},

{“Key”:“screenPopOnNoMatch”,“Value”:“true”}

]

變數清單

這些變數可用於具有以下參數的 openframe 配置:

  • 尋找變數
  • 客戶記錄映射
  • 案例記錄映射
  • 活動記錄對應
變數名稱變數說明
阿尼發話號碼
DN受話號碼
身份證找到的記錄的 CRM 識別碼
wrapUpAuxCodeId代理選擇的整理原因的 Id
wrapUpAuxCodeName代理選擇的整理原因之名稱
虛擬團隊名稱指派給通話的團隊名稱
shareRecordIdCRM 活動的 Id
Rona 逾時無人接聽時響鈴參數的值 
[[自定義 Webex CC 變數]]在 Webex CC 流程設計器上定義的變數的名稱 

此範例顯示如何將 ani、dn wrapupAuxCodeId、wrapupAuxCodeName 儲存到互動的簡短描述欄位中:

{“Key”:“activityRecordMapping”,“Value”:“short_description= {ani} / {dn} / {wrapUpAuxCodeId} / {wrapUpAuxCodeName}”}

點選撥號 UI 巨集 (經典 UI)

使用 ServiceNow 的可配置工作區時,將自動啟用單擊以撥號電話記錄。使用經典 UI 檢視時,必須導入更新集才能在電話記錄上獲取相同的功能。下載“按兩下以撥號”更新集,然後按照以下步驟將“按兩下以撥號”功能添加到經典 UI。 

1

轉到 所有>系統更新集>檢索到的更新集

2

單擊 從 #導入更新集 XML

3

單擊“ 選擇檔”,選擇下載 的“點選撥號 UI ”巨集 .XML 檔,然後按兩下“上傳

4

按兩下上傳後的名稱以打開 更新集

5

完成後,按兩下 預覽,更新,設置 關閉

6

完成後,按下 提交更新設置 關閉

7

打開現有記錄以配置點擊撥號。

8

右鍵按下電話記錄名稱,然後按下「 配置字典」。

9

單擊 “相關連結下的 “屬性 Tab”上的“新建”。

10

選擇 “字段修飾” 作為屬性,鍵入 click_to_call_wxcc 作為值,然後按兩下“提交

11

按兩下撥號 按鈕現在應該在錄製頁面上可見。

12

對任何其他電話欄位重複此動作。

WebRTC

ServiceNow 連接器在以下瀏覽器上支援 WebRTC

  • 火狐
  • Google Chrome

但是,Microsoft Edge 瀏覽器不支援 WebRTC。

要啟用 WebRTC,請確保:

  • Webex CC 桌面設定檔允許桌面。
  • 您在 openframe 組態集中擁有具有正確網域名稱的 webRtcDomain 組態金鑰。
  • 瀏覽器重新整理需要您登出後再登入。
  • 可以從“選項”功能表選擇裝置 (微型/耳機)。

更新 ServiceNow 屬性

  1. 以管理員身分登入您的 ServiceNow 實例。
  2. 從「全部」功能表中搜尋 sys_properties.list

  3. 搜索名稱為 sn_openframe.cross.origin.access 的屬性。

  4. 使用以下參數編輯記錄並新增「 」欄位:

    麥克風*;自動播放;揚聲器選擇

限制

如果代理在通話中拔下作用中的預設裝置,則需要透過「喇叭和麥克風」設定手動選擇新裝置。

目前在 Firefox 中無法選擇喇叭和麥克風。

版本更新

此更新 (與 2025 年 9 月 22 日相關) 解決了以下增強功能:

  • 無需安裝新的套件。

功能與改進

  • 添加了對啟用直接轉移到入口點的支援。
  • 能夠更新外撥 ANI 設定。
  • 引入了 WebRTC 靜音和取消靜音功能。

檔案室

2025 年 8 月

功能與改進

  • 新增了在進行中 WebRTC 通話期間將麥克風靜音和取消靜音的功能。
  • 在登入螢幕上的撥號號碼欄位中預先填入預設撥號號碼,以便加快登入速度。
  • 支援動態更改團隊、DN 和電話選項,以獲得更大的靈活性。
  • 通過包括相關記錄來改進資訊訪問,從而增強了 CRM 查找。

2025 年 7 月

功能與改進

  • 允許選擇電話號碼作為去電的來電者 ID。
  • 添加了使用 WebRTC 時切換麥克風和揚聲器設備的功能。
  • 提供了拒接來電的選項,以獲得更多控制。

2025 年 6 月

功能與改進

  • 在預設身份驗證 URL 中新增了 Spark WebRTC 通話的範圍。
  • 切換事件跟蹤以改進分析和報告。
  • 允許選擇用於通話的音訊輸入和輸出設備。

2025 年 5 月

功能與改進

  • 代理狀態與下班後活動 (AWA) 同步。
  • 為 ServiceNow OEM 啟用 WebRTC 並添加了鈴聲支援。
  • 顯示佇列中的諮詢通話以提高可見度。
  • 改進了語音通話記錄中「斷開連接原因」欄位的準確性。
  • 從自訂的「CC 代理」角色中移除系統角色。

2025 年 3 月

功能與改進

  • 創建了與通話結束時交互連結的電話日誌,以改進跟蹤。
  • 為螢幕彈出行為添加了新的配置選項。
  • 已啟用啟動螢幕由服務現在中的 Webex Contact Center 流彈出。
  • 基於 Webex Contact Center 組態的增強型語音通道登入選項。
  • 支持諮詢、會議和到入口點的熱轉接。
  • 透過更新到最新的清單連絡服務佇列 API 改進整合。
  • 通過在顯示警報時自動關閉打開的抽屜來增強用戶體驗。

2025 年 1 月

功能與改進

  • 從使用電話日誌轉換為交互進行呼叫活動。
  • 接受表名稱作為案例表和客戶表的配置輸入。
  • 改進了客戶和案例記錄映射中的變數解釋。
  • 僅在可見選項卡中自動創建的不匹配記錄。
  • 通過清理 LogRocket 的操作來增強數據隱私。
  • 允許在通話期間編輯通話相關資料。
  • 更新了 Webex Contact Center 請求的 API 端點。
  • 將功能表選項更新為側邊欄佈局,以便於導航。